Skip to content
Verified Commit 28574d10 authored by ivan tkachenko's avatar ivan tkachenko 🗯
Browse files

Adjust blur offset behind plasmoid to match plasmoid itself (second try)

Previous fix somehow did not account for (literally) edge cases, such
that the background became transparent near right and bottom edges of
containment.

This patch rewrites and centralizes sizing calculations, optimizes
attached properties access, removes redundant IDs, replaces
OpacityMask::maskSource ShaderEffectSource with a simple clipped Item,
and avoid being smart about reparenting to plasmoid.

See also: 0bbba7a7

(cherry picked from commit cede2681)
parent f68b2908
Pipeline #241640 passed with stage
in 10 minutes and 39 seconds
0% or .
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ment